| Material Type | PLA biopolymer |
| Renewable Resource Content | Derived from annually renewable resources |
| Density | 1.24 g/cm³ |
| Melt Flow Rate 210 C 2 16 Kg | 22 g/10 min |
| Melting Temperature | 165-180 °C |
| Glass Transition Temperature | 55-60 °C |
| Tensile Strength At Yield | 60 MPa |
| Tensile Modulus | 3.5 GPa |
| Tensile Elongation At Break | 3.5% |
| Flexural Strength | 80 MPa |
| Flexural Modulus | 3.5 GPa |
| Notched Izod Impact Strength | 2.5 kJ/m² |
| Heat Deflection Temperature 0 455 Mpa | 55 °C |
| Vicat Softening Temperature | 60 °C |
| Crystallization Temperature | 100 °C |
| Mold Shrinkage | 0.3-0.5% |
| Recommended Print Temperature | 190-220 °C |
| Recommended Bed Temperature | 0-60 °C |
